TPS2061DBVR Single Channel USB Power Distribution Switch
The TPS2061DBVR from Texas Instruments is a versatile, high-quality power distribution switch specifically designed for USB applications. This compact and efficient device is housed in a 5-pin SOT-23 package, making it an ideal choice for space-constrained applications. The TPS2061DBVR allows a USB port to supply up to 1.5A of continuous current to downstream devices while providing protection features to ensure the stability and safety of the system.
One of the key features of the TPS2061DBVR is its integrated over-current protection, which safeguards the USB port from excessive current that could potentially damage the host device or the peripheral. Additionally, the device includes thermal shutdown protection, which automatically turns off the switch if it overheats, thereby preventing thermal damage.
This power switch also supports a wide operating voltage range from 2.7V to 5.5V, making it suitable for a variety of USB-powered devices and applications. Its low on-resistance (typically 70mΩ) ensures minimal voltage drop and power loss, which is critical for maintaining efficient power distribution in USB systems.
The TPS2061DBVR also features a built-in charge pump that reduces the number of external components required, thus simplifying design and reducing overall system cost. The charge pump supports the drive for an N-channel MOSFET, which acts as the power-distribution switch, providing a compact and efficient solution for USB power management.
For designers looking for a reliable and robust USB power distribution solution, the TPS2061DBVR offers fault status reporting through an open-drain fault output pin. This feature allows for immediate system response to fault conditions, enhancing system reliability.
